You'll want to begin by going over a few of the basics. A resume that is tailored to the job you want can make all of the difference. In fact, a counselor can go over your resume piece by piece and tweak different sections to make them more palatable. Having a resume that is completely free of spelling and grammatical errors is an absolute must.

Whenever you are actually going to be applying for a job, you'll want to write individualized cover letters to the companies you are targeting. Cover letters should always be addressed to the person whose attention you want to catch. Beyond this, you might also send a thank-you note after you have completed an interview with the hiring manager.

You can also work on your interview skills. By understanding what companies are looking for, you can come to the interview prepared. Projecting a strong personality is one good way to create an excellent impression. Counselors can do formal mock interviews with you so that you know what to expect during the real thing.

You should always seek out a counselor who has been working in the field for a little while and who is familiar with the employers in the local area.
